site stats

Generic tables react typscript

WebApr 12, 2024 · The usehooks-ts package is an open-source, typescript-based, tree-shakable collection of useful react hooks that we can use in our react application. One of the most useful hooks it offers is the useLocalStorage and useReadLocalStorage hooks. These hooks allow use to read and write to the browser's localStorage API with ease. WebDec 2, 2024 · Step 3: Create a Validated Input Component. We want create a wrapper component that uses both our component and react-hook-form to create a reusable component that can be passed any validation rules and any potential errors. Let's make a new component called .

How to use LocalStorage in React by Using a Custom Hook

WebApr 28, 2024 · Generic table component props. We are going to implement a generic table component. Here’s our generic props type: type Props = { data: DataItem[]; … tavern papine jamaica https://fourde-mattress.com

React and TypeScript: Generic Search, Sort, and Filter

WebDec 21, 2024 · In this article we will create a generic Table component that can be used with any set of objects. 22-Dec. React Create a generic table with React and … WebGeneric Table with React and Typescript. Edit the code to make changes and see it instantly in the preview By fernandoabolafio Forked from React Typescript template Template type: create-react-app Likes: 4 Views: … WebMay 27, 2024 · Code Samples. Gives an overview of the code used in the demo.For the full code, see its repository.. All custom types that will be shown in these examples are described in-depth at the bottom of this document, in … tavern on 4 \u0026 5

TypeScript: Documentation - Generics

Category:React forwardRef(): How to Pass Refs to Child Components

Tags:Generic tables react typscript

Generic tables react typscript

How to create reusable form components with React Hook Forms and Typescript

WebJul 19, 2024 · It basically works this way, Pass an array of string for the header. pass an array of object for the table list item. and inside the table component its self, I loop through the two arrays to render their individual … WebJun 28, 2024 · Definition. TypeScript Generics is a tool that provides a way to create reusable components. It creates a component that can work with a variety of data types rather than a single data type. It ...

Generic tables react typscript

Did you know?

WebApr 23, 2024 · If you are creating a new React app using create-react-app v2.1 or higher, Typescript is already built in. So, to set up a new project with Typescript, simply use --typescript as a parameter. npx create-react-app hello-tsx --typescript. This creates a project called my-app, but you can change the name. WebApr 11, 2024 · Here's some more detailed information on how to convert JavaScript files to TypeScript: Rename .js files to .tsx or .ts: This is a simple step that you can do to …

WebDec 12, 2024 · Let me explain it briefly. – package.json contains 5 main modules: react, typescript, react-router-dom, axios & bootstrap. – App is the container that has Router & navbar. – types/Tutorial.ts exports ITutorialData interface. – There are 3 components: TutorialsList, Tutorial, AddTutorial. – http-common.ts initializes axios with HTTP base Url … WebJul 20, 2024 · Initiate the project: npm init. To install TypeScript with create-react-app, run the following one-liner in your terminal: npx create-react-app . The command above will create a simple folder structure for your application, then install all the necessary modules and get your project up and running for you.

WebOct 9, 2024 · Typescript has been heavily influenced by C#, so it has some C-like structures and this is not an exception. Typescript defines and uses generics the same way C# does, with angle brakes ( < and > ). So, in order to use generics we need to declare them with angle brakes. In functions. // Using named functions function … WebDec 19, 2024 · React+TypeScript + any WebAPI or local json file= Generate Table Dynamically. Generate a Dynamic Table Skeleton to which we can feed any API or local …

WebOct 27, 2024 · Where the genericSearch was used on a filter array function, the genericSort function will be of course applied as a callback to an array sort call. So, this needs to be a comparator function, accepting an 'a' and 'b' object of type T, as well as the currently active sorter: export function genericSort ( objectA: T, objectB: T, sorter ...

WebYou can reference types with the “@type” tag. The type can be: Primitive, like string or number. Declared in a TypeScript declaration, either global or imported. Declared in a JSDoc @typedef tag. You can use most JSDoc type syntax and any TypeScript syntax, from the most basic like string to the most advanced, like conditional types. /**. tavern on kruse lake oswego oregonWebJavaScript with syntax for types. TypeScript is a strongly typed programming language that builds on JavaScript, giving you better tooling at any scale. Try TypeScript Now. Online … bateria asus a32-k53 originalWebRow Data: . Provide a Typescript interface for row data to the grid to enable auto-completion and type-checking whenever properties are accessed from a row data … tavern plus plankWebJul 7, 2024 · Tables can explain a large amount of complex data in a short time. React is a JavaScript library widely used to build user interfaces and the frontend of applications. We can use React with both JavaScript and TypeScript. We must install all the dependencies to create a data table in React. But first, we will install react-dom using the below ... bateria asus a41n1424WebMar 4, 2024 · Save your file and enter the command npm start in your terminal to start the server on localhost:3000/.. You'll see that the only thing on your localhost:3000 page is the header. Feel free to kill the server so that you can focus on the code, otherwise leave the terminal open and running to see the changes as you go. bateria asus a32-n61WebIn this article, I'll be covering how to create a pagination component in react with TypeScript. The aim is to make it as generic as possible. It will be a presentation component, also known as “dumb component” because it only displays the html with styles (doesn't have state or logic). As usual, my aim is to be able to have it working in ... tavern plusWebDec 18, 2024 · Learn one thing at a time instead of following a random tutorial which is about introducing typescript into a react project – Aluan Haddad Dec 18, 2024 at 7:43 bateria asus a32 k55 4700mah 50wh